Is it possible to encode hundreds of unspent outputs into a single QR code?

I am considering using a QR code to transfer unspent outputs to an air gapped computer for the purpose of signing a Bitcoin transaction offline. Has anyone had experience with using QR codes for transferring large amounts of data? Can a QR code of this size be accurately scanned, or would it be too large?

